MESSAGE OF THE PRESIDENT. Richmond, Va., Feb. 16, 1863. To the House of Representatives: I herewith transmit a communication from the Secretary of War, covering a list of all the civilians now in custody, under authority of the War Department, in the city of Richmond, being a response in part to your resolution of the 5th instant. JEFFERSON DAYIS. COMMUNICATION FROM SECRETARY OF WAR. Confederate States of America, y War Department, > Richmond, Ya., Feb. 14, 1863. > His Excellency, The President : Sir : In response to a resolution of the House of Representatives', I have the honor to enclose the report of General J. H. Winder,, covering a list of all the civilians now in custody, under authority of the War Department, in the city of the Richmond. Very respectfully, Your obedient servant, JAMES A. SEDDON, Secretary of War. REPORT OF BRIGADIER GENERAL JOHN H. WINDER. Headquarters Department Henrico, ) February 13, 1863. ) Hon. J. A. Campbell, Assistant Secretary of War: Sir : I have the honor herewith to enclose " a list of all the civilians now in custody, under authority of the War Department," in the city of Richmond, together with the information required by 4he late resolution of the House of Representatives.
